Why Live in Beaver

Beaver, UT is a small but growing community located along Interstate 15, offering expansive views of the Tushar Mountains. The town is experiencing new job growth, particularly in manufacturing, which is attracting more residents. Despite its growth, Beaver maintains a peaceful atmosphere with access to outdoor recreation, including hiking and camping in the nearby Tushar Mountains and Fishlake National Forest. Local dining options include Mel’s Drive Inn on Main Street and Timberline Restaurant off I-15, while The Creamery offers high-quality cheese and ice cream. For shopping, residents often visit Cedar City, located over 50 miles away, for larger chain stores. Housing in Beaver features ranch-style homes, cottages, bi-levels, and some Pueblo Revival-style houses, with many properties spanning over a quarter-acre. The town also has several parks, such as Pioneer Park and Main Street Park, and hosts an annual Pioneer Day Celebration with horse races, a rodeo, and a parade. Beaver Valley Hospital serves the community, and Cedar City Regional Airport is about 55 miles away. Schools in Beaver are highly rated, with Belknap Elementary earning an A-minus grade. The town's safety is comparable to the national average, making it a practical choice for families.
